Being lonely is not a feeling reserved for people
Workers at the Kaikyokan Aquarium in Shimonoseki, Japan, saw one of their Sunfish experience loneliness

I read the lonely Sunfish story in ***MeWrites.***
I was reminded of the primate experiments conducted by scientists during the 1950s and 60s.
Research that would not be allowed today.
Here is one experiment I remembered.
A female primate who was subjected to stress eventually bore a child. She rejected the child and refused to bond with the newborn.
She was placed with other Moms. The group saw her behavior and went into action. They collectively taught her how to be a Mom.
It is easy to think that good behavior comes naturally without a need for learning.
Our son, born in 1979, gave me a chance to be a dad.
In the breakroom, I was telling my workmates all of the ways I would raise him.
Someone said, “You’re raising a child, not a science experiment.”
He was right.
